“Self-defeating consequences such as the ones we have been describing are psychologically intriguing, because they run counter to the assumption that people will always act in their own self-interest. John Jost, a psychologist at New York University, has suggested that, contrary to that expectation, people in fact are willing to sacrifice their self-interest for the sake of maintaining the existing social order. His experiments have shown that we do cognitive and emotional work to justify the hierarchies that make up the status quo, even when that means imposing costs on ourselves as well as on the groups to which we belong.”
― Blindspot: Hidden Biases of Good People
